Are train conductors in demand?
Overall employment of railroad workers is projected to grow 5 percent from 2020 to 2030, slower than the average for all occupations. Despite limited employment growth, about 7,000 openings for railroad workers are projected each year, on average, over the decade.

Where do train conductors sleep?
Conductors and engineers sleep at home or at a hotel at their away terminal. The operating crew of a train in the US can only be on duty for 12 hours and then must be relieved.

How long are train conductor shifts?
Conductors work long days (anywhere from 11 to 13 hours, typically), they have to maneuver heavy machinery in sometimes terrible weather conditions, and they can’t really plan time off for birthdays, holidays, and anniversaries.
How many hours a day do train conductors work?
Depending on the terrain and location you are stationed, your trip can range from 2-3 hours to all 12 hours, which is the longest shift that the FRA (Federal railroad administration) will allow a crew to stay on duty and active.
What do train conductors do when they hit someone?
When a train hits someone or something on the tracks, Davids says, the first thing the crew does is record the time and call the train dispatcher to report an incident. Dispatch then alerts emergency responders while the train crew runs back to the point of collision to see if they can help.
How hard is it to be a train engineer?
The actual hardest part of all, is being on call, 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, with no clue as to when it will be time to go to work, or which train will be worked, or sometimes which route will be used depending on the different routes or directions that an engineer could be called upon to operate the trains.

Do conductors drive trains?
What Does A Locomotive Engineer and Railroad Conductor Do? Locomotive engineers drive passenger and freight trains, while conductors manage the activities of the crew and passengers on the train. Conductors may take payments or tickets from passengers and assist them when they have any difficulties.

How do you become a train engineer?
To become a railroad engineer, you will need a high school diploma or equivalent and 1-3 months of on the job training with specialized equipment, classroom instruction and periodic continuing education and training. You must receive railroad engineer certification from the Federal Railroad Administration.
Do you have to steer a train?
“Well, with the trains, there is no steering wheel. They’re on those rails so the rail is the only direction of travel they can go in.” … “Typically the front, most forward locomotive is positioned in the direction of travel, however every other locomotive on there can be facing either direction,” Jacobs said.
How far does a train engineer travel?
While some of the longer freight run mileage is around 300 miles while other runs are less than 100 miles depending upon the territory, and density of the train traffic on a run, where there are many trains using the same track the run has to be shorter to allow meets and passes among freight trains.
